About the Role

We are seeking an experienced Finance Business partner who brings excellent negotiation, influencing and communication skills to join the Coles Finance team, focused on our Meat Retail remit.

This role will see you working side by side with the Merchandise team to deliver sales, margin and cost targets, leveraging your financial expertise and strong communication skills to enable informed decision making and drive digital business strategy.

You will also;

  • Identify opportunities to drive sales over and above plans
  • Ensure plans are in place to deliver the strategic objectives of the business unit
  • Liaise with Meat Production team to provide insight and understanding of impacts to P&
    L from livestock and production costs
  • Drive insight and ROI analysis for transformational projects and business cases
  • Identify and define process and/or system improvements to enhance ability to deliver on objectives
  • Track key initiatives and promotions to ensure they are on target to delivered expected outcome
  • Drive the monthly forecast process ensuring all risk and opportunities are understood and communicated


About you and your skills


We are looking for a driven Finance Business Partner who is comfortable challenging and influencing key stakeholders, competent in data-driven storytelling, and capable navigating complex problems and ambiguity.

You will also ideally have;

  • CA/CPA or similar business qualification, or near with commercial awareness and business focus
  • Financial experience in a retail/FMCG or big 4 environment desirable, but not essential
  • TM1 and PowerBI experience desirable
  • Strong Excel, financial modelling, and PowerPoint skills
  • Proven experience in preparing, understanding and analysing financial information to identify business opportunities/challenges and recommend course of action
